I currently have 6 Holiday Inn reservations for this summer. Each was made online at their website. They have NOT charged my credit card for any of them.

I believe you probably booked using a Best Available rate to save a few dollars per night. Those are the only rates that require advanced payment. There is no refund if cancelled. That would have had to have been mentioned. If so, that would have been a clue they were charging it now.

Other rates like, AAA, military, Entertainment, and so on are not charged until you get there.
